OSCR Technical Breakdown



Zooming out on the macro perspective: The price is consolidating within the 0.618 and 0.786 logarithmic Fibonacci retracement levels. This range marks a critical consolidation zone that could signal the next directional move.

Narrowing down to the weekly timeframe: We're caught between two key pressure points—the 100-week Simple Moving Average providing support from below, while the Kijun line coupled with the Ichimoku cloud resistance sits overhead. This squeeze typically precedes a breakout.

The interplay between these Fibonacci levels and moving averages suggests OSCR is in a bottleneck phase. Watch for a break above or below this range to confirm the next impulse move. Keep an eye on volume to validate any breakout attempt.
